    Q
    Is Bayer Advanced Brush Killer Plus Concentrate harmful to pets?
    A

    Bayer Advanced Brush Killer Plus Concentrate is pet safe when used as directed.  Pets must be kept out of the area while the product is being applied, but can safely return once everything is dry.

    Q
    How long do I have to wait after it rains to apply Bayer Advanced Brush Killer Plus Concentrate?
    A

    Per the product label on the Bayer Advanced Brush Killer Plus Concentrate there is no set time frame after it rains to apply, but you would want to wait until the ground is dry and there is no water puddled up. You would also need to be sure there will be no rain or water for 4 hours after application so the product has time to dry.

    Q
    Lost label. What is the right mixture for the Bayer Advanced Brush Killer Plus Concentrate?
    A
    Per the product label: Add 4 fl. oz. (1/2 Cup or 8 TBSP) to 1 gallon of water to treat up to 500 square feet. Do not apply more than 9 lbs ai/acre triclopyr (17 oz brush killer per 500 square feet) per year.

    Q
    Dormant trees
    Is it effective against mature dormant trees? Someone online said to make a slit in the bark and paint it on. Is it dependent upon girdling the tree?
    A
    In order to kill a tree of any kind, you will first need to cut the tree first. Once that is done, you will use undiluted Bayer Advanced Brush Killer Plus Concentrate on the stump. This will be applied with a paintbrush. Discard the paintbrush once complete with this project.

    04/30/2016
    Q
    Do I have to add a surfactant with the Bayer Advanced Brush Killer Plus Concentrate to be effective?
    A

    Adding a surfactant to Bayer Advanced Brush Killer Plus Concentrate is fine and can increase the effectiveness but on the label is does not specify it is required.
